/ˈnoɚm/
- Noun
- standards of proper or acceptable behavior
- social/cultural norms
- an average level of development or achievement
- She scored well above/below the norm in math.
- something (such as a behavior or way of doing something) that is usual or expected
- Smaller families have become the norm.
- Women used to stay at home to take care of the children, but that's no longer the norm.
